Understanding the fundamentals of ethical hacking in cybersecurity
The Definition of Ethical Hacking
Ethical hacking, often referred to as penetration testing or white-hat hacking, involves authorized attempts to exploit vulnerabilities in a system or network. Unlike malicious hackers, ethical hackers operate under a strict code of conduct, with the primary goal of identifying weaknesses to fortify security. They are often employed by organizations to simulate attacks, providing invaluable insights into potential security flaws and recommending improvements. Tools and services that support this process, such as ip stresser, can assist in creating realistic testing scenarios.
Ethical hacking encompasses various techniques and methodologies designed to evaluate system security. Professionals in this field utilize tools and frameworks to mimic cyberattack scenarios, which helps organizations understand where their defenses may be lacking. By following ethical guidelines and operating transparently, ethical hackers maintain trust and integrity while assisting in building more resilient cyber infrastructures.
The growing reliance on digital systems has magnified the importance of ethical hacking. With the increase in cyber threats, organizations recognize that proactive measures are more effective than reactive responses. Ethical hackers not only help in patching existing vulnerabilities but also contribute to the development of security policies and protocols, thereby enhancing the overall cybersecurity posture of an organization.
Common Techniques Used in Ethical Hacking
Ethical hackers employ a variety of techniques to assess and enhance security systems. Among the most common methods are reconnaissance, scanning, gaining access, maintaining access, and analysis. During the reconnaissance phase, hackers gather intelligence about the target to identify potential vulnerabilities. This could involve researching public data or employing automated tools to map network architecture.
Scanning follows reconnaissance and involves more detailed probing of the target system. Tools such as network scanners can be used to discover active devices, open ports, and potential security loopholes. Once vulnerabilities are identified, ethical hackers can exploit these weaknesses to gain access. This phase often involves using various attack vectors, such as social engineering or malware, to assess how far they can penetrate the system.
After gaining access, ethical hackers analyze the data obtained to evaluate how well the system performed under attack. This analysis helps organizations understand the potential damage a real cyberattack could inflict. By documenting vulnerabilities and recommended fixes, ethical hackers play a crucial role in refining an organization’s cybersecurity strategy, thereby preventing future incidents.
The Role of Tools and Technologies in Ethical Hacking
Ethical hackers rely heavily on an array of tools and technologies designed to facilitate penetration testing. These tools range from network scanning software to more complex exploitation frameworks. Popular tools like Metasploit, Nmap, and Wireshark are staples in an ethical hacker’s toolkit, each serving distinct functions in the testing process. Metasploit, for example, is often used for developing and executing exploit code against remote targets.
Moreover, the integration of artificial intelligence and machine learning into these tools has transformed the landscape of ethical hacking. These technologies enhance the capabilities of ethical hackers by automating routine tasks, allowing them to focus on more complex vulnerabilities that require human intuition and problem-solving skills. The evolution of tools has not only increased efficiency but also the accuracy of findings, resulting in more robust security measures.
Additionally, ethical hackers often employ frameworks that standardize their methodologies, ensuring consistency and comprehensiveness in their assessments. Common frameworks such as OWASP and NIST provide guidelines that ethical hackers can follow to ensure they cover all necessary areas during a penetration test. By adhering to these standards, ethical hackers enhance the reliability of their assessments and improve the overall security landscape for the organizations they serve.
Legal and Ethical Implications of Ethical Hacking
Understanding the legal and ethical implications of ethical hacking is crucial for both practitioners and organizations. Ethical hackers operate under a framework that emphasizes consent and legal authorization. They must ensure they have explicit permission before conducting any testing, as unauthorized access—even with good intentions—can lead to severe legal consequences. This underscores the importance of clarity in contracts and agreements between ethical hackers and their clients.
Furthermore, ethical hackers are expected to adhere to a strict code of ethics, which includes maintaining confidentiality and integrity. Once vulnerabilities are identified, ethical hackers have a duty to report these findings responsibly and take necessary measures to protect sensitive data. Failure to do so can lead to a breach of trust, damaging both the hacker’s reputation and the client’s standing.
The ethical landscape of hacking is continuously evolving, making ongoing education and awareness vital. As new laws are introduced and technologies change, ethical hackers must stay informed to operate within legal boundaries. Organizations also bear responsibility for fostering a culture that prioritizes cybersecurity and ethical practices, ensuring that their systems remain secure and compliant.
Conclusion and the Role of Stresse.rip in Cybersecurity
In summary, ethical hacking plays a vital role in the ever-evolving field of cybersecurity. By understanding the principles and techniques involved, organizations can better prepare themselves against malicious attacks. Ethical hackers not only identify vulnerabilities but also contribute to creating robust security policies that minimize risks. Their expertise is invaluable in protecting sensitive data and maintaining trust with customers and stakeholders.
Platforms like Stresse.rip provide essential resources for security teams and infrastructure engineers by offering authorized network load testing. This service helps organizations measure their network capacity accurately, ensuring they can withstand potential attacks. By focusing on structured testing and adhering to ethical standards, Stresse.rip enhances accountability and provides performance insights that are crucial for effective cybersecurity management.
